William Gilvin “Gil” Bates, the South Carolina state wrestling champion, crossed paths with lab assistant Kelly Bates (née Callaham) at Anderson University, a Christian liberal arts school in South Carolina. She was assigned to help him with Chemistry. Displaying their intellectual prowess, he asked for her hand in marriage in October 1987 while they were both attending Carson-Newman University in Tennessee. They decided to tie the knot only two months later. Initially, they didn’t envision a big family, but neither of them endorsed the use of birth control. In an interview with Dateline in 2011, Gil shared that they chose to trust God on the matter of their children’s number, expecting to have no more than two or three.

The oldest child, Zachary Bates, was born a year after their wedding; the 19th addition to their family, Jeb Bates, came in 2012. When it comes to reciting the names of their large family, Kelly teasingly mentioned Gil, who owns Bates Tree Service, saying, “Oh, Daddy’s great at that. His memory is sharper than mine.”

Zachary, born on December 30, 1988, was educated at home like his siblings and was deeply involved in Bill Gothard’s Institute of Basic Life Principles. His relationship with Sarah Reith was featured on “19 Kids and Counting,” but it was Whitney Perkins who won his affection while working at Sonic Drive-in. They began courting in 2013, and he proposed just two months later. The wedding took place that December, with John-David Duggar serving as one of the groomsmen. The couple subsequently had sons Bradley (born October 2014), Jayden (June 2021), Kaci (June 2016), Khloé (November 2019), and Lily Jo (August 2023).

Besides his work at the family tree company, Zachary has also held positions such as a police officer, a county commissioner, and a real estate agent.

On January 23, 1990, Michaela Bates Keilen entered the world, approximately 13 months following her older brother’s birth. As a youngster, she developed a knack for sewing and was responsible for creating many of the family’s dresses and managing the laundry. Brandon Keilen, who would later become her husband, had to wait until his graduation from bible college before he could propose. Consequently, they dated for two years prior to their engagement in April 2015.

Following their August wedding, the couple moved to Chicago and faced challenges in starting a family. Michaela openly shared her fertility issues through blog entries and YouTube videos. Sadly, they experienced a miscarriage in 2021, but later welcomed two young boys into their lives as foster parents.

Nathaniel Kenneth Bates, often known as Nathan, became part of our family on August 29, 1993. His romantic journey with Ashley Salyer was highlighted in the show Bringing Up Bates, but he later got engaged to Esther Keyes in May 2021. They exchanged vows in October of the same year (mirroring many of his siblings by sharing their first kiss at the altar). A daughter named Kenna was born a year later, and in October 2024, they were blessed with a son, Graham. Since childhood, Nathan had aspired to be a preacher, which he pursued through various mission trips and roles as a first responder.

Alyssa Bates Webster, born on November 9, 1994, served as the family’s secretary, shopper for clothing, and prepared numerous meals. During her work on Florida Congressman Daniel Webster’s campaign for the U.S. House of Representatives, she encountered his son John Webster. In January 2014, they became engaged at Orlando’s Ruth’s Chris Steakhouse, and got married that May. The couple residing in Florida had their first child, Alli, in April 2015, followed by Lexi in January 2017, Zoey in March 2018, Maci in February 2021, and Rhett in March 2023.

Born on February 1, 1997, Trace Bates, whose name signifies a harvester of white fields, entered the world. On television, he courted Chaney Kahle before being introduced to his future spouse, Lydia Romeike, by his sister Josie Bates Balka. They announced their engagement in March 2022 on YouTube (where Trace shared, “I just know that Lydia is my best friend, and she’s the most positive influence in my life”), and they tied the knot in October of the same year before 350 guests, including Jason Duggar who served as an usher. Their first child, Ryker, was born in October 2023. In June 2025, they were blessed with a rainbow baby, their daughter Kaia.

On April 11, 1998, Carlin Bates Stewart completed high school together with her brother Trace. They had taken dual enrollment at a local college. Carlin’s sister Erin introduced her to Evan Stewart, and the couple revealed their engagement in September 2018. Marrying the next year (with Joy-Anna Duggar Forsyth serving as a bridesmaid), they welcomed daughter Layla in January 2020 on the show “Bringing Up Bates.” Their son Zade was born in March 2022, and they announced the upcoming arrival of their third child in February 2025.

Gil and Kelly welcomed their tenth child on August 4, 1999. She met her future spouse, Kelton Balka, at a piano recital in 2014, but they didn’t start dating until 2017. They got engaged in June 2018 during a proposal caught on camera, and tied the knot that October, once more under the watchful eyes of cameras. Their first daughter, Willow, was born in July 2019, with Hazel joining the family in June 2021. Miles became part of the family in February 2024, and the couple announced they were expecting another child in April 2025.

On October 5, 2000, Katie Bates Clark was given the name that means “pure grace.” In a 2019 Facebook Live session, she publicly announced her romance with Travis Clark, sharing their picturesque engagement on an oceanfront in April 2021. They exchanged vows in December of the same year and welcomed their daughter Hailey into the world in February 2023. Their family expanded further with the arrival of their son Harvey in September 2024. Katie holds a cosmetology license, which she has utilized working as a stylist for her sister Josie’s company, Effortless Beauty, and as a model for Bates Sisters Boutique.

Among the group often referred to as the ‘three musketeers’, which includes Warden Bates, Isaiah Bates, and Jackson Bates, it was Jackson who was born on February 17, 2002. He crossed paths with his future wife, Emerson Wells, at a rodeo in Florida, with their engagement being announced in March 2023. The wedding took place in October of the same year, with Jason Duggar serving as a groomsman. Their first child, David, arrived in July 2025.
